Industrial automation environments impose extreme demands on communication hardware. Electrical noise from variable frequency drives, high-voltage switching equipment, and heavy motor loads can induce signal drift, data corruption, and intermittent communication faults that cascade into unplanned shutdowns. The ALR121-S51 S1 addresses these risks through robust hardware design, including enhanced EMI shielding, surge suppression circuitry, and galvanic isolation between communication channels. These features collectively reduce the risk of signal drift, module misoperation, and communication anomalies that can compromise interlock integrity and safety instrumented system (SIS) performance.

For safety loop integrity, the ALR121-S51 S1 supports deterministic communication latency, which is essential in applications where the control system must respond to process deviations within defined time windows. In emergency shutdown (ESD) and fire-and-gas (F&G) systems, communication delays or dropouts can prevent timely actuation of safety valves, deluge systems, or isolation dampers. The module’s reliable data throughput ensures that the CENTUM VP controller receives accurate, real-time field data from remote I/O nodes, enabling the safety logic to execute without hesitation. Surge and transient protection is a defining characteristic of the ALR121-S51 S1’s design. In environments where lightning strikes, capacitor bank switching, or large motor starts generate high-energy transients on communication lines, unprotected modules are vulnerable to permanent damage or latent degradation that manifests as intermittent faults. The ALR121-S51 S1’s internal protection circuitry clamps transient voltages before they can damage sensitive communication ICs, extending module service life and reducing unplanned replacement events. This is particularly valuable in offshore platforms, mining operations, and port automation facilities where maintenance access is constrained and spare parts logistics are complex.

Control Cabinet Protection Strategy
A robust CENTUM VP control cabinet is built on layered protection across power, communication, I/O, and safety domains. The ALR121-S51 S1 sits at the heart of the communication layer, but its reliability depends on the integrity of every adjacent component. Clean, regulated power from AIP588 power supply modules eliminates the voltage ripple and transient spikes that cause communication resets. Redundant power feeds, managed through AIP578 units in dual-supply configurations, ensure that a single power supply failure does not interrupt the communication link between the FCS and remote I/O nodes.
On the I/O side, AAI141 analog input modules and AAI543 analog I/O modules feed process variable data into the FCS via the communication backbone established by the ALR121-S51 S1. Digital interlock signals from field devices are routed through ADV151 digital output modules and ADV141 digital input modules, which must maintain signal integrity under the same harsh conditions. Any communication degradation between these I/O modules and the FCS — whether caused by noise, surge, or module aging — can result in false trips, missed alarms, or delayed safety responses.
For facilities operating in classified hazardous areas, Zener barriers and galvanic isolators installed upstream of the I/O modules provide an additional layer of protection against intrinsically safe circuit violations. The AMN11 node interface unit coordinates communication between multiple remote I/O nodes and the FCS, and its health is directly dependent on the ALR121-S51 S1 maintaining a stable, error-free communication link. Regular diagnostic polling via the CENTUM VP HIS (Human Interface Station) allows maintenance teams to monitor communication error rates and proactively replace aging modules before failures occur.
